Marvin Gaye: Rainbow Theatre, London

Rosalind Russell, Record Mirror, 21 June 1980

MARVIN GAYE'S show on Sunday was pure class. A bit schmaltzy in places, but still classy. When he arrived onstage in a conservative dark jacket, shirt and tie, I wasn't sure what to expect — from him or his cast of thousands. But the minute his three backup singers swung into their finger-poppin' routine, things looked up.
